Summary

The renewable energy company has signed a $465 million EPC contract with Casale to build its flagship green fertilizer facility in Paraguay, marking a major milestone in the project's development.

Atome Plc has signed a definitive $465 million EPC contract with Casale S.A. for the construction of its 260,000 tonnes per annum green fertilizer plant in Villeta, Paraguay. The contract has a fixed price and a timeline of 38 months from Final Investment Decision (FID) to the start of production. This represents a significant revenue opportunity for the company, as the contract value is substantial compared to Atome's current market capitalization. The involvement of Casale, a leading international ammonia and fertilizer contractor, as the EPC contractor provides strong validation for the project. Additionally, Atome has recently secured an equity investment of up to $115 million from Hy24, the world's largest low-carbon hydrogen asset manager, as the anchor and lead investor for the Villeta project, reducing the funding risk.
